Maurizio Sarri’s Chelsea welcome Ligue 1 side Lyon to Stamford Bridge in their final pre-season matchup ahead of their opening Premier League fixture away to Huddersfield at the weekend.

The Blues looked lacklustre in their 2-0 defeat to Manchester City on Sunday afternoon in their Community Shield clash. In turn, Sarri will be looking to end pre-season on a high after suffering defeats to Inter Milan and Arsenal during their summer travels.

With regards to line-ups, Chelsea fans will be familiar with some of Lyon’s players as former Chelsea man Bertrand Traore returns to the Bridge after sealing a switch to France last summer. Former Manchester United winger Memphis Depay is also starting for the visitors.

As for Chelsea, Sarri has opted to give many of the club’s youngsters a chance to shine before the season starts. 19-year old Marcin Bulka starts in goal having produced some eye-catching saves during the pre-season friendlies.

Ethan Ampadu is also starting along with Andreas Christensen and Ruben Loftus-Cheek, with the latter given the chance to impress the home fans after catching the eye of many with his performances at the World Cup.

Striker Tammy Abraham leads the Chelsea line, and featuring for the first-team perhaps signals that the forward will be staying in west London this season and won’t be heading out on loan again.

If that’s the case, the 20-year-old will be eager to make a strong impression on Sarri and to show that he is a capable alternative to the likes of Alvaro Morata and Olivier Giroud.
